Apple Cider Vinegar Side Effects
Apple cider vinegar contains a large amount of organic acids, so long-term use can corrode the tooth surface and damage the teeth.
Taking it together with insulin, digoxin, or diuretics may cause health problems, so it is recommended to consult a specialist. In addition, if you consume too much undiluted liquid, it can damage the esophagus, so you need to be careful when taking it.
For those with weak stomach, it is recommended to take it after a meal rather than on an empty stomach.
